Syafi'i Blog's'

Rabu, 24 Desember 2008

nilai_akhir

import javax.swing.*;
public class nilai_akhir {

public static void main (String[] args)
{
String ket;

String input1=JOptionPane.showInputDialog("NIM Mahasiswa");
int A=Integer.parseInt(input1);

String input2=JOptionPane.showInputDialog("Nama Lengkap");
int B=Integer.parseInt(input2);

String input3=JOptionPane.showInputDialog("Prosentase Kehadiran ");
int C=Integer.parseInt(input3);

String input4=JOptionPane.showInputDialog("Nilai Ujian Tengah Semester");
int D=Integer.parseInt(input4);

String input5=JOptionPane.showInputDialog("Nilai Ujian Akhir Semester");
int E=Integer.parseInt(input5);

String input6=JOptionPane.showInputDialog("Nilai Tugas");
int F=Integer.parseInt(input6);

double na=0.4*D+0.45*E+0.1*F+0.05*C;

System.out.println("NIM Mahasiswa :"+A);
System.out.println("Nama Lengkap :"+B);
System.out.println("Prosentase Kehadiran :"+C);
System.out.println("Nilai Ujian Tengah Semester :"+D);
System.out.println("Nilai Ujian Akhir Semester :"+E);
System.out.println("Nilai Tugas :"+F);
System.out.println("Nilai Akhir :"+na);

if (na > 80)
{
ket="Grade A";
}
else if ((na>=70) && (na <=80 ))
{
ket="Grade B";
}
else if ((na>=60) && (na <=69 ))
{
ket="Grade C";
}
else if( (na>=50) && (na <=59 ) )
{
ket="Grade D";
}
else if (na <=58)
{
ket="Grade E";
}
else
{
ket=" Tidak Lulus";
}

System.out.println("Grade :"+ket);
System.exit(0);
}


}

script ini belum sempurna karena insert nama masih belum bisa di isi dengan huruf,
bagi sapa saja yang membaca tolong perbaiki ya
makasih sebelumnya

0 komentar:

Template by : auraipank x-template.blogspot.com